‘Trofeo Sospeso’ is our response to VIA’s request to design and fabricate the winner’s trophy for the KX Community Race. It’s inspired by the idea that the victor will only hold on to the trophy until the next year’s race, at which point they’ll pass it on to the new winner. In a sense, the trophy is suspended in time. And to us, that sounded like a cycling version of the old Neapolitan tradition of ‘Caffè Sospeso’, the act of paying for two cups of espresso but consuming only one, leaving the other ‘sospeso’ for a stranger to ask for and enjoy at some point in the future. It’s a community kindness as alive today as it was in the late 1800s when it originated in the working-class cafés of Naples.

Our design incorporates circles to represent the bicycle’s wheels, freedom and the ancient symbol of infinity, with vertical tubes extending to the sky to mimic the arms-raised winner’s gesture. The piece is finished with a Ciavete scheme as a colour expression of the concept.
